Career Research Project 
The Career Research Project requires a career to be researched based on career interest.

Career Job Description

Advanced

Detailed description of the job is required. Information on job responsibilities is given along with the frequency in which they are done.
Proficient

Description of the job is required. Information on job responsibilities is given.
Basic

Description of the job is required.
Below Basic

No description of the job is included
Career Educational Requirements

Advanced

There is a detailed description of the educational requirements. It provides information on any degrees, certificates, licences, or other special requirements. It also privides the estimated time required to complete requirements.
Proficient

There is a description of the educational requirements. It provides information on any degrees, certificates, licences, or other special requirements.
Basic

There is a description of the educational requirements.
Below Basic

There is NO description of the educational requirements.
Career Salary

Advanced

There is a detailed description of of the salary for this career. It gives the yearly, monthly, and hourly rate, if applicable.
Proficient

There is a description of of the salary for this career. It gives the yearly, monthly, and hourly rate, if applicable.
Basic

There is a description of of the salary for this career.
Below Basic

There is NO description of of the salary for this career.
Personal Interest

Advanced

Develop a detailed description of why student is so interested in this particular career
Proficient

Develop a description of why student is so interested in this particular career
Basic
Below Basic

Did NOT develop a description of why student is so interested in this particular career
Career Background

Advanced

Includes detailed and insightful information about the history of the profession
Proficient

Includes detailed information about the history of the profession
Basic

Includes some information about the history of the profession
Below Basic

Does not include any information about the history of the profession
Introduction/Closing

Advanced

The introduction is compelling and provides motivating content that hooks the viewer from the beginning of the project and keeps the audience's attention.
The closing summarized the essay effectively ending with a thought provoking closing statement
Proficient

The introduction is motivating content that keeps the audience's attention.
The closing summarized the essay and ended with a thoughtful statement
Basic

The introduction is present, but simply explains.
There was a closing but it did not summarize the essay
Below Basic

The introduction and closing are missing or irrelevant.
Spelling and Grammar

Advanced

0-1 errors
Proficient

2-3 error
Basic

3-4 errors
Below Basic

More than 4 errors
Formatting

Advanced

Proper MLA format with 0 errors in essay and works cited page
Proficient

Proper MLA formatting with 1-2 errors in essay and works cited page
Basic

MLA format with many errors
Below Basic

Not in MLA format
Citations

Advanced

Sources of information are properly cited so that the audience can determine the credibility and authority of the information presented.
Proficient

Most sources of information use proper citation, and sources are documented to make it possible to check on the accuracy of information.
Basic

Sometimes citation guidelines are followed, but it is hard to check for accuracy of information
